🚨Acute food insecurity happens when any part of the food system—availability, access, use, or stability—is disrupted by shocks or crises.

The #GRFC reports a rise in food insecurity in 53 countries.

"It is the sixth consecutive year that the number of people facing 'high levels of acute food insecurity' has risen, reaching 295.3 million according to the latest Global Report on Food Crises (GRFC). The figure represents almost a quarter – 22.6% – of the population of 53 countries analysed."
"[A]lmost 300 million people [are] at risk of death through starvation."

"More than 95% of them lived in the Gaza Strip or Sudan, although Haiti, Mali and South Sudan had significant populations suffering similar food shortages."
